请现在做前端有没有必要学css hack

谢邀!学前端时可以不特意去学,但做前端的时候,如果任务要求,不学怎么行呢?
■网友
现在的前端开发重点貌似一直在往手机端偏移,PC端各浏览器兼容的开发比重也少了,同时电脑系统也不断升级,ie老版本也一直在淘汰,而且前端开发现在用框架也非常多,这些框架本身的兼容性就非常高,所以各方面导致现在用css hack解决兼容性问题的比重下降了不少。但是不代表用不到css hack,你依然得学,但是得讲究方法。css hack这东西更偏重实践,手册属性更多一些,现用现查更为合适。也就是说你把它当作基础理论知识那样去学,可能在以后的项目中会出现不会用或者是用不好的问题。所以我们只要知道有css hack这个东西就行,也推荐去了解一下,但不要当作必备的知识点。等实践的时候,发现有些地方不兼容了,就要想到用到css hack了,这时候再去搜索再去学习也来得及。当然不兼容的时候首先推荐不要用css hack解决问题,先从布局啊或其他解决方式入手,如果解决不了,再用css hack,等经验积累多了,css hack自然也就用的顺手了。


    推荐阅读